  • New START and Verification

    Updated: 2010-12-13 23:21:00
    New START contains an updated, streamlined, and more cost-effective system of verification procedures that are tailored to the treaty’s limits, reflect the realities of the current U.S. and Russian arsenals, and, most importantly, will allow the U.S. to effectively verify Russia's compliance with the treaty.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ff Admiral Mike Mullen testified that, “in totality, I’m very comfortable with the verification regime that exists in the treaty right now.”

  • New START and Tactical Nuclear Weapons

    Updated: 2010-12-13 23:21:00
    New START does not impose limits on non-strategic warheads. No previous arms control agreement has limited these weapons. While experts agree that tactical weapons present difficult challenges, there was not sufficient time to reach an agreement on nonstrategic forces during this round of negotiations. The best way to address tactical nuclear weapons is to ratify the New START agreement as soon as possible, and then to begin negotiations with Russia on nonstrategic forces, which the Obama administration intends to do.

  • New START and Missile Defense

    Updated: 2010-12-13 23:21:00
    According to Secretary of Defense Robert Gates, New START “will not constrain the United States from deploying the most effective missile defenses possible, nor impose additional costs or barriers on those defenses.” While Russia is concerned about U.S. missile defense plans, the Obama administration kept missile defense on a separate track from reductions in strategic offensive arms during the New START negotiations.
